Area Monitoring

An area monitor is used to provide one or more of the following:

  • early warning

  • remote monitoring

  • continuous monitoring

  • perimeter or fenceline monitoring

An area monitor provides benefits similar to those of a fixed gas detection system although they have the portability to be transported and repositioned to suit your application needs.

An area monitor is a safety device that is used to monitor a specific area for the presence of hazardous gases, vapors, or radiation. By monitoring the air quality in a specific area, area monitors can help to identify and prevent potential accidents and protect workers from exposure to hazardous substances.

Area monitors can be used to detect a wide range of hazardous substances, including:

  • Toxic gases: Carbon monoxide, hydrogen sulfide, nitrogen dioxide, sulfur dioxide, chlorine, ammonia
  • Flammable gases: Methane, propane, methane, ethane, hydrogen
  • Vapors: Organic vapors from solvents and other chemicals
  • Radiation: X-rays, gamma rays, alpha particles, beta particles

Area Monitor Sensors

Area monitors typically have a sensor that detects the presence of a hazardous substance and a display that shows the concentration of the substance. Some area monitors also have alarms that will sound if the concentration of a hazardous substance exceeds a certain level.

Sensor Ranges include*:

Ammonia, high-range ammonia, carbon dioxide, carbon monoxide, high-range carbon monoxide, chlorine, chlorine dioxide, COSH, hydrogen cyanide, hydrogen sulfide, high-range hydrogen sulfide, hydrogen-resistant carbon monoxide, LEL-infrared, LEL-pellistor, nitrogen dioxide, oxygen, ozone, photoionization detector, sulfur dioxide

*refer to each model's specifications for sensor and gas compatibility.

Types of Area Monitors include:

  • Gas area monitors: These monitors are used to detect the presence of hazardous gases in the air. They are typically used in industrial settings where there is a risk of gas leaks or spills.
  • Radiation area monitors: These monitors are used to detect the presence of ionizing radiation in the air. They are typically used in nuclear power plants and other facilities where radioactive materials are present.
  • Environmental area monitors: These monitors are used to monitor the quality of the air, water, and soil in a specific area. They are typically used by environmental agencies to track pollution levels and to identify potential environmental hazards.

Industries that will benefit from a Portable Area Monitor

Area monitors are used in a variety of industrial and commercial settings, including:

  • Chemical plants
  • Oil and gas refineries
  • Power plants
  • Water treatment facilities
  • Food and beverage processing plants
  • Pharmaceutical manufacturing facilities
  • Hospitals
  • Nuclear power plants
